Location: 572B Lincoln Avenue Winnetka, IL 60093 GENERAL SUMMARY: The Medical Assistant supports the provider in many aspects of the office encounter. Works under the supervision of the Practice Manager.

Requirements

  • Minimum High School Diploma or general equivalency diploma (GED)
  • Excellent organization and communication skills
  • Strong knowledge and level of comfort with EPIC or other EMR system preferred
  • One year of experience in a clinical environment
  • Computer literacy
  • CPR certification

Nice To Haves

  • Certification as a Medical Assistant preferred

Responsibilities

  • Performs vitals, rooms patients and gathers specimens.
  • Documents necessary information in the EMR.
  • Collects specimens, performs in-office lab testing and prepares specimens for outside labs.
  • Assists with in-office patient procedures per protocol and training.
  • Contributes to the daily upkeep of office space and equipment.
  • Demonstrates and supports PediaTrust Core Values.
  • Performs cleaning and disinfection of instruments and equipment based on practice protocol.
  • Performs digital health workflows and initiatives.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
